"Longview" is a very unique property...consisting of two separate buildings which offer togetherness & privacy, simultaneously. The main home & artist's studio cottage are surrounded by a split brook & nestled in a forest backed by a mountain view & fronted by the ocean.
It is centrally located in the charming fishing village of Long Cove, on the famed Avalon Peninula (National Geographic Destination 2010) This small, friendly community has an authentic working outport harbour & is home to the original "Three Jolly Fishermen", recognized world-wide as Newfoundland icons.
Here is the opportunity to view the comings & goings of local fishermen, buy fresh fish & lobsters, see whales & view seasonal icebergs...all out your front door.
The main house offers 1200 sq. ft of living space; 2 bedrooms, a full eat-in kitchen, 4 pce. bath, & open livingroom, all charmingly decorated in a nautical theme using local antiques. An 800 sq. ft. covered deck with patio heater & outdoor lighting afford ample protected space to relax & breathe in the salt air in all weather conditions.
Within steps, sits the 720 sq. ft artists' studio cottage, which features 14 ft. cathedral ceilings, a 4 pce. bath, bedroom & living room, encircled by glass railings, which provide unobstructed views
of Trinity Bay & the renowned Seaview Hiking Trail.
This exceptional property is perfectly located as a jumping off point for day trips to St. John's, Terra Nova National Park, Hearts Content, Trinity & Brigus..

About the owner: Michael and I are retired professionals, and spend our time travelling between Ontario, Newfoundland and Florida with our 3 lucky dogs. Michael is a well know artist, who spends his time painting the endlessly beautiful Newfoundland landscapes, and selling them at the Peter Lewis gallery here in St.John's. I spend my time in Newfoundland, reading, baking, rug hooking and creating canvas floor mats. As a child, I had the good fortune to spend my summers in Long Cove, where my ancestors first settled in the 1700's, a family of fishermen & master shipbuilders. Both the lure of the sea & the legendary warmth of the Newfoundlanders captured my heart early on, but the opportunity to become residents only presented itself, three years ago.
Why the Owner Chose Norman's Cove:
My family settled in Trinity Bay in the 1700's. where the Newhook's were renowned ship builders. I spent many summers growing up with my aunts, uncles and cousins, and when this property became available, we jumped at the opportunity.
